(11bS)-2,6-Bis[bis[3,5-bis(trifluoromethyl)phenyl]hydroxymethyl]-3,5-dihydrospiro[4H-dinaphth[2,1-c:1',2'-e]azepine-4,4'-morpholinium] Bromide

description Product Description
This chemical is primarily utilized in the field of organic synthesis and catalysis, particularly in asymmetric reactions. Its unique structure, featuring multiple trifluoromethyl groups and a spirocyclic framework, makes it highly effective as a chiral catalyst or ligand. It is often employed in enantioselective transformations, such as hydrogenation, cyclization, or cross-coupling reactions, where high stereocontrol is required. The presence of electron-withdrawing trifluoromethyl groups enhances its reactivity and selectivity in complex organic reactions. Additionally, its stability and solubility in various organic solvents make it suitable for use in industrial-scale chemical processes, particularly in the pharmaceutical industry for the synthesis of chiral drug intermediates.
